Jesse Sisgold worked in the Los Angeles office of Heller Ehrman LLP from 2003 until 2008 before joining Valle Makoff LLP. While a junior lawyer at Heller, Los Angeles Magazine named Jesse a “Rising Star.”

Jesse’s practice focuses on complex commercial and intellectual property disputes. He also has experience in antitrust, entertainment, First Amendment and securities law.

Representative matters include:

  • Successfully represented several financial institutions in significant deal-related negotiations and/or disputes, including Ares Management, Credit Suisse Securities, Washington Mutual Bank and Bank of America;
  • Managing a brand protection program and obtaining multi-million dollar summary judgments for a Fortune 500 consumer product manufacturer in trademark infringement cases;
  • Successfully representing Yahoo! Inc. in a merger-related government investigation; and
  • Co-counseling a Ninth Circuit case with the ACLU to successfully remove a sexual orientation discrimination policy from government-funded foster care and adoption organization.

In addition to his litigation experience, Jesse has negotiated a variety of corporate transactions including entity formation, operating, stock and asset purchase agreements, intellectual property licenses, and executive and artist agreements.

Active in public interest matters, Jesse serves as the Chair of the ACLU Next Board, Director on the Board of SOL-LA Music Academy, and Chair of the Board for Angels at Risk, a non-profit offering substance abuse counseling to at-risk teenagers and their families.  While in law school, Jesse taught “Street Law” civics to low-income teenagers.

Jesse earned his J.D. cum laude in 2002 from University of California, Hastings College of the Law, where he received the Legal Writing American Jurisprudence Award and Moot Court Best Oral Argument Honors. He received his B.A. in economics with Provost Honors and a minor in theater from University of California, San Diego in 1998.
